    This is a great starting point to expand on road safety whereby you can set-up small world play with cars and road mats but the most fun is outdoor road signs.

    We have made our own signs (CD Exploring media and materials) written the words (CLL Writing) and speed limtis (PSRN Using Numbers) then set them up on the grass, I used cereal boxes cut into rounds for the signs and then sellotaped to broom handles or garden canes and either stuck into the grass or held up in parasol bases.

    The children then darted around the obstacle course on ride on cars (PD). I would encourage communication and observing the signs between the children (PSE) and then later followed up by printing out photos we had taken of traffic lights and lollipop ladies, etc and use them as flash cards whenever we go out. It keeps them quiet in the car also as they are trying to spot the pictures whilst out and about (KUW)
